How parents pay school fees
The first-ever survey of how parents pay independent school fees, shows that three-quarters of them have to reduce their spending in other areas to do so and that one family in six spends more than 40% of household income on school fees.
The survey, of 900 parents currently paying independent school fees, has been conducted jointly by mtmconsulting ltd, the leading business consultancy in the independent education sector, and Holmwoods Termtime Collections (HTC), the largest provider of monthly fee payment facilities to independent school parents.
The survey discloses for the first time the extent of the inroads that the payment of school fees makes into family budgets. More than four out of five of the parents surveyed spend up to 40% of their net income on school fees; 16% of them devote more than 40% to paying for their children’s education.
